Description:

Kanamycin A related Compound 1 is a bioactive molecule with antiviral activity. It has been shown to inhibit the enzyme activity of influenza virus neuraminidase, which is necessary for the release of virions from infected cells. The mechanism of action of Kanamycin A related Compound 1 has been elucidated by molecular simulations and mutant strain studies. Kanamycin A related Compound 1 inhibits an aspartate residue in the active site of influenza virus neuraminidase, leading to decreased virion production and increased viral aggregation at the cell surface. This compound also has antibacterial properties against soil bacteria and can be used as an analytical reagent for determining amino acid residues that are important for enzyme activity in other enzymes.
